New medical jobs to be created
Monday 18th August 2008
A number of new positions are to be created in the health industry in Shropshire, those seeking UK medical jobs may be interested to hear.
Premier Medical - a Ludlow-based firm with around 120 staff members - is looking to create 40 new positions in the country by the end of 2008, the Shropshire Star reports.
In addition, the business is seeking to expand its workforce by 100 by 2012.
Commenting on the developments, Jason Powell for Premier Medical said: "The business is looking to expand the number of staff in [its Ludlow] office by 30 per cent this year to 150."
